Exciting 2-day wildlife safari to Lake Mburo National Park, one of Uganda’s most beautiful yet often overlooked parks. Tucked away in the western region of the country, this park is renowned for its rich biodiversity, open savannahs, and acacia woodlands dotted with zebras, impalas, and buffaloes. This short but action-packed safari combines nature, adventure, and a touch of cultural discovery, including a scenic stopover at the Uganda Equator, where you can stand in both the Northern and Southern Hemispheres at once.

Experience the serenity of the wilderness during a guided walking safari, get up close to wildlife on a sunset game drive, and enjoy the tranquility of a boat cruise on Lake Mburo, known for its birdlife, hippos, and crocodiles.

Day-by-Day Itinerary

Day 1: Transfer to Lake Mburo National Park via the Equator Stopover

Morning: Departure from Kampala or Entebbe

Your adventure begins early in the morning with pick-up from your hotel or airport. You’ll journey southwest towards Lake Mburo National Park, a scenic 4–5-hour drive that showcases Uganda’s countryside.

Along the way, you will stop at the Equator Monument in Kayabwe – a popular geographical landmark. Here, you'll take captivating photos while standing on the imaginary line that divides the Earth into the Northern and Southern Hemispheres. Enjoy brief demonstrations that show how water swirls differently in each hemisphere. You can also shop for souvenirs or enjoy a cup of Ugandan coffee at one of the nearby craft shops.

Afternoon: Arrival at Lake Mburo National Park

Upon arrival at the park, proceed to check in at your selected safari lodge. Take some time to relax and enjoy lunch as you soak in the peaceful surroundings of the park.

Evening: Sunset Game Drive

Later in the evening, embark on a guided game drive through the park’s rolling landscapes and savannahs. Lake Mburo is home to a wide range of animals including zebras, impalas, buffaloes, elands, and topis. Unlike other parks in Uganda, Lake Mburo lacks elephants, making walking and driving safaris particularly unique and safe.

As the sun begins to set, the golden light creates a picturesque backdrop ideal for wildlife photography. The peaceful ambiance of the park in the evening makes this a truly special experience.

Overnight: Return to your lodge for a hearty dinner and overnight stay.

Day 2: Walking Safari & Boat Cruise – Return to Kampala/Entebbe

Early Morning: Guided Walking Safari

Wake up to the sounds of nature and prepare for a guided walking safari, led by an experienced Uganda Wildlife Authority ranger. This immersive experience allows you to walk safely through the bush and observe wildlife from a close but safe distance. Learn about animal tracks, bird calls, medicinal plants, and the ecosystem that makes Lake Mburo so unique.

Expect to encounter antelopes, zebras, warthogs, and various bird species. Walking in the wild is a rare opportunity to connect with nature in its raw form – something that few safari destinations offer.

Mid-Morning: Boat Cruise on Lake Mburo

After the walking safari, head to Lake Mburo for a scenic boat ride. As you glide across the water, watch for hippos cooling off, crocodiles basking on the banks, and an array of birdlife such as African fish eagles, kingfishers, and herons. The lake is also a great spot for photographers and nature lovers.
